## Tallowgate Environments: Tax-Rate Lookup Cache

Tallowgate resolves tax rates through the Lintrose lookup service, with results cached per-jurisdiction in each environment. Dev and staging use a short TTL so rate-table changes surface quickly; production uses a longer TTL with an explicit invalidation hook triggered by Lintrose publish events. Maintainers should never edit cache settings directly on hosts — changes go through the environment manifest. For reference, the production cache currently runs with the following values.

deployment values, yadup-kadug:
[sorys]
port = 5672
team = noveth
host = sorys.orvexcorp.example
region = south-4
access_code = ac_deddc1
timeout_ms = 1500

# Schemaforge — Environments

Plugin authors: Schemaforge runs sandbox, staging, and prod registries. Register and test event schemas in sandbox only; staging mirrors prod compatibility rules but purges weekly. Prod registration requires a reviewed compatibility check — breaking changes are rejected automatically. Versioning is append-only everywhere. Your plugin should read endpoints and policy modes from config, never hardcode them. The sandbox registry exposes the following configuration values.

service settings:
[casax]
port = 6379
team = rusir
host = casax.zemvarhq.corp
region = outer-4
access_code = ac_9808ce
timeout_ms = 1500

### Step 4: Reconfigure the alert fan-out

Stormline's weather-alert fan-out moves from polling to a push model in this release. Disable the legacy poller before enabling the push workers, or subscribers will receive duplicate alerts during the overlap window. Regional shard counts were rebalanced after the Harlow Basin incident, so do not copy old values forward. Backpressure is now handled per-region rather than globally. Apply the following configuration to each fan-out node.

settings of kawif-tawig:
[pelok]
port = 5432
region = lower-3
host = pelok.crelvocorp.example
team = fraox
timeout_ms = 750
retries = 7